yorcreative/laravel-argonaut-dto
Lightweight, composable Laravel DTO package to transform arrays/objects/collections into typed, validated data objects. Supports deep nested casting, type-safe conversion, Laravel Validator rules, explicit attribute priority, clean toArray/toJson serialization, and immutable readonly DTOs.
|
Package
|
Score
|
Description
|
Stars
|
Likes
|
Forks
|
Downloads
|
Issues
|
Score
|
Opportunity
|
License
|
Last Release
|
|
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| open-southeners/laravel-dto | 0.87 | — | 10 | 10 | 1 | 90 | 2 | 26.8 | 16.4 | MIT | 1 month ago | |
| dayploy/js-dto-bundle | 0.86 | — | 0 | 0 | 1 | 68 | 0 | 0.0 | 25.0 | MIT | — | |
| 24hoursmedia/tesla-dto-bundle | 0.85 | — | 0 | 0 | 0 | 0 | 0 | 0.0 | — | — | — | |
| dreadnip/smart-dto-bundle | 0.84 | — | 0 | 0 | 0 | 0 | 0 | 0.9 | — | MIT | 3 years ago | |
| dayploy/dart-dto-bundle | 0.83 | — | 0 | 0 | 0 | 82 | 0 | 0.1 | 25.9 | MIT | — | |
| solido/dto-management | 0.83 | Manage, discover, and enhance DTOs in PHP apps with Solido DTO Management. Provides tools to register and locate DTO classes and apply enhancements consistently across your codebase. Documentation and contribution guides available. | 2 | 2 | 1 | 54 | 0 | 0.1 | 10.8 | MIT | — | |
| wendelladriel/laravel-validated-dto | 0.82 | Build typed Data Transfer Objects for Laravel that validate incoming data using familiar validation rules, defaults, and casting. Create DTOs by extending ValidatedDTO, define rules(), and get safe, validated, ready-to-use properties for your app. | 763 | 762 | 47 | 24K | 1 | 35.2 | 24.1 | MIT | 1 week ago | |
| dragon-code/simple-dto | 0.82 | Lightweight PHP DTO helper: define simple DataTransferObject classes, build instances via make(), map nested input keys to properties, and (optionally) cast values. Supports upgrade paths from older package names. Note: author recommends spatie/laravel-data instead. | 9 | 9 | 2 | 20K | 0 | 2.6 | 32.1 | MIT | 2 years ago | |
| bujanov/dto-bundle | 0.82 | — | 0 | 0 | 0 | 0 | 0 | 0.0 | — | MIT | — | |
| spatie/data-transfer-object | 0.81 | PHP 8+ data transfer objects with “batteries included”: map and cast input arrays into typed DTOs, validate via attributes, and handle nested objects/collections. Note: package is deprecated; consider spatie/laravel-data or cuyz/valinor. | 2,227 | 2,192 | 189 | 509K | 0 | 12.9 | 23.0 | MIT | 3 years ago | |
| maestroerror/laragent | 0.62 | LarAgent is an open-source AI agent framework for Laravel. Build and maintain agents with an Eloquent-style API, pluggable tools (incl. MCP server support), memory/context management, multi-agent workflows, queues, and structured output for reliable integrations. | 638 | 635 | 58 | 15K | 6 | 6.3 | 55.3 | MIT | 3 weeks ago | |
| laraigent/larai-kit | 0.61 | — | 14 | 13 | 3 | 1 | 0 | 20.5 | 0.5 | MIT | 1 month ago | |
| martian/laravatar | 0.60 | — | 6 | 6 | 3 | 0 | 0 | 0.7 | — | MIT | 2 years ago |
How can I help you explore Laravel packages today?